Introducing Mr. and Mrs. McGraw!

Morgan Stewart and Jordan McGraw officially tied to knot on Wednesday in a private wedding ceremony, several months after getting engaged and announcing that they are expecting their first child together.

The couple shared the happy news in coordinating Instagram posts.

"Btw ... Jordan and Morgan McGraw," the Nightly Pop co-host captioned a photo of the newlywed couple sharing a kiss in front of standing in front of a white rose-covered backdrop adorned with candles.

McGraw also posted a photo, showing the couple smiling after saying "I do."

"12-9-20," read his caption.

On Friday's Daily Pop, Stewart, 31, opened up about the last-minute ceremony.

"It was really quick," she said of the planning process, adding that they didn't tell any of their friends beforehand. "Because the last time I told people about when I wanted to surprise you about the baby, everybody knew everything before I even got the chance," she said. "So I just wanted this to be a real surprise for the first time."

Stewart announced the news of their engagement in July when she posted a photo of herself in a bathing suit showing off her diamond ring.

The couple then revealed they were expecting a baby girl just weeks later when they popped a balloon with pink confetti on Instagram.

"Been working on my dad jokes for years," McGraw, the son of Phil McGraw, captioned the video.

In March, Stewart — who filed for divorce from ex Brendan Fitzpatrick last year — confirmed she had been dating the "FLEXIBLE" singer for three months.

"Hot couple? Thank you!" she read aloud during her show.

While their relationship was still in the early stages at the time, Stewart revealed that she actually briefly dated McGraw when she was younger.

"We dated 10 years ago for a year and then he broke up because he was like, 'I'm not down with you, bitch,'" she said. "And then I was like. 'Fine, whatever, I'm over you, I don't care.’ And then I went on obviously to have another relationship."
